Gary Neville once again passed Manchester City to retain their title despite Arsenal reopening their eight-point lead, but the critic backed Arsenal to win the Premier League if they win at Anfield next weekend.

Defending champions Man City briefly cut Arsenal’s lead to five points by beating Liverpool 4-1 early in the game on Saturday.

Arsenal responded by beating Leeds United by the same scoreline to restore the eight-point lead, although City had a game in hand.

Neville told Sky Sports that Arsenal passed another test by responding to City’s early victory, but he expects to build pressure on Mikel Arterta’s side in their last nine matches.

The former Manchester United defender believes City’s experience could prove decisive in the second round of the title.

However, Neville announced that victory over Liverpool at Anfield on 9 April would result in Arsenal being crowned champions.

“Arsenal are in an incredible position, they have real confidence,” Neville said.

I still think City will because they have more experience, it’s 50/50. I was sure about six weeks ago and thought Arsenal would drop points but I think City will continue to do so.

I wouldn’t put everything at Anfield but if Arsenal go there and win I will say it’s definitely their title, our manager used to say if you win there you win the title.

“Anfield is a terrifying place to go, if they win at Anfield I think they will win it.

I think if City are four points away when they play them, if City play Arsenal on their shoulders, the pressure on their shoulders will be unbearable.

“We’ve been chasing Newcastle and they’ve stumbled badly, Arsenal don’t stumble but they have really tough games when you’re taking your first title to a lot of these guys.”

Neville’s teammate Jamie Redknapp has highlighted Arsenal’s upcoming away matches as key to whether Arteta’s side can claim the title.

The Premier League leaders will travel to Liverpool, West Ham, Man City, Newcastle and Nottingham Forest for their final away games of the season.

“You look at their away games, Newcastle trying to get into the top four, desperately trying to get where they think they belong.

“Liverpool away from home is a tough game, and the games they play are key.

“Until we get to the last three or four races of the season, we don’t know how they will react because of the way they gave up in the first four races last season.”
